re PR middle-end/52584 (Fails to constant fold vector upper/lower half BIT_FIELD_REFs)
2012-03-16 Richard Guenther <rguenther@suse.de> PR middle-end/52584 * fold-const.c (fold_ternary_loc): Fold vector typed BIT_FIELD_REFs of vector constants and constructors. From-SVN: r185468
